Output 8a5256549936f1098ca40e233a71ea8c9fe522b4ea385cd2db2b81815d54346e:2

value
2604659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bd5113507747adeaf3fc52d27fe87109ab39dc OP_EQUAL
address
3Qe6KeYieV3ftjZN3mVjDQMAazwaJW2taT
transaction
8a5256549936f1098ca40e233a71ea8c9fe522b4ea385cd2db2b81815d54346e
spent
true